Transaction 25e05cfbd66034785f007b9860e1da34b2095104f191cfe33bc991fa09855a3e

1 Input
2 Outputs
  • 25e05cfbd66034785f007b9860e1da34b2095104f191cfe33bc991fa09855a3e:0
  • value  700000
    address  3QddcvoZWB93NKxe7Tg9YwP7qZzqRqk6bT
  • 25e05cfbd66034785f007b9860e1da34b2095104f191cfe33bc991fa09855a3e:1
  • value  51642
    address  bc1qtnmg9juaga846n37rdu6rlyt5f6qmqsccddggh